fromJson static method
Returns a new FightSchema instance and imports its values from
value if it's a Map, null otherwise.
Implementation
// ignore: prefer_constructors_over_static_methods
static FightSchema? fromJson(dynamic value) {
if (value is Map) {
final json = value.cast<String, dynamic>();
// Ensure that the map contains the required keys.
// Note 1: the values aren't checked for validity beyond being non-null.
// Note 2: this code is stripped in release mode!
assert(() {
requiredKeys.forEach((key) {
assert(json.containsKey(key),
'Required key "FightSchema[$key]" is missing from JSON.');
assert(json[key] != null,
'Required key "FightSchema[$key]" has a null value in JSON.');
});
return true;
}());
return FightSchema(
xp: mapValueOfType<int>(json, r'xp')!,
gold: mapValueOfType<int>(json, r'gold')!,
drops: DropSchema.listFromJson(json[r'drops']),
turns: mapValueOfType<int>(json, r'turns')!,
monsterBlockedHits:
BlockedHitsSchema.fromJson(json[r'monster_blocked_hits'])!,
playerBlockedHits:
BlockedHitsSchema.fromJson(json[r'player_blocked_hits'])!,
logs: json[r'logs'] is Iterable
? (json[r'logs'] as Iterable).cast<String>().toList(growable: false)
: const [],
result: FightResult.fromJson(json[r'result'])!,
);
}
return null;
}
